Weights computed by us.
| 854 g | 3 1/2 cups milk |
| 85 g | 6 tablespoons salted butter (cut into pieces) |
| 200 g | 4 large eggs |
| 9 g | 2 teaspoons vanilla |
| 480 g | 4 cups all-purpose or white whole wheat flour or a combination (see note) |
| 25 g | 2 tablespoons granulated sugar |
| 6 g | 1 teaspoon salt |
| 9 g | 1 tablespoon instant yeast |
